There are many causes of bad breath, which can be generally divided into two categories: one is exogenous (food, medicine), which is usually temporary, and the other is endogenous. Exogenous bad breath that disappears on its own in a day or two does not belong to halitosis. The halitosis disease referred to in medicine mainly refers to endogenous bad breath. Usually, this type of bad breath can be determined to be halitosis if it lasts for more than 20 days. Endogenous halitosis mainly includes: 1. Prevention measures for bad breath in children:

1. Cultivate the habit of paying attention to oral hygiene in children from an early age, and make sure they rinse their mouths after meals and brush their teeth in the morning and evening. It is best to develop the habit of rinsing your mouth after meals, especially paying attention to removing meat scraps remaining in the gaps between teeth. This type of high-protein food is most likely to cause bad breath.

2. Pay attention to keeping your mouth moist and drink water frequently.

3. Eat regularly. Eat more vegetables and fruits, and combine coarse and fine foods. Don’t be picky or biased about food, and don’t overeat.

4. Actively treat diseases that cause bad breath, such as periodontitis, hepatitis, stomach disease, etc.

5. Don’t eat too much when eating, as overeating can easily cause bad breath.

6. The fasting time should not be too long, as it can easily lead to bad breath.

7. Bad breath caused by eating irritating foods (such as garlic) can be eliminated by chewing tea leaves, chewing gum or eating a few dates.
